Hi,
I have a matrix with 10^7 rows and 17 columns.
Column number 17 is the time and I want to add another column, 18, that will have the delta of these time steps..
for example:
1
5
15
will yield
4
10
I get do loops cause there are 10^7 million rows.. it would take ages. Any ideas? Perhaps a boolian expression would do the trick? Thanks!!!

Use the diff (link) function, and add a ‘0’ to the output, so the row lengths will be the same:
time = [ 1
5
15]
dtime = [0; diff(time)]
producing:
time =
1
5
15
dtime =
0
4
10
